US: Fan-Shaped Lava Fountain Erupts From Kīlauea Summit
United States - July 09, 2025 At approximately 6:30 a.m. HST on July 9, 2025, a fan-shaped lava fountain erupted during episode 28 of the ongoing Kīlauea summit eruption. The eruption was captured from the north rim of Kaluapele, near Kīlauea Overlook inside Hawaiʻi Volcanoes National Park. Episode 28 lasted for nine hours, with the final eight hours marked by high lava fountaining. Throughout the episode, the south vent remained inactive and has now been completely buried by new lava deposits.
